- Financial Statement Analysis: You'll learn how to dissect and interpret financial statements (balance sheets, income statements, and cash flow statements) to assess a company's financial health and performance. This includes understanding key ratios and metrics, identifying trends, and detecting potential red flags. Mastering this skill is fundamental to making sound investment decisions.
- Valuation Techniques: The course will cover various valuation methods, including discounted cash flow (DCF) analysis, relative valuation (using price-to-earnings ratios, price-to-book ratios, etc.), and asset-based valuation. You'll learn how to apply these techniques to estimate the intrinsic value of a company and determine whether it's overvalued or undervalued by the market.
- Financial Modeling: You'll gain hands-on experience in building financial models using spreadsheet software. This includes creating projections of future financial performance, performing sensitivity analysis, and evaluating different scenarios. Financial modeling is a highly sought-after skill in the finance industry.
- Risk Management: Understanding and managing risk is crucial in financial analysis. You'll learn how to identify, assess, and mitigate various types of risk, including market risk, credit risk, and operational risk. This will enable you to make more informed and prudent investment decisions.
